🙂A single person spends $436 per month in Ondo vs $1,392 in Ubud, Bali, rent included.
🙂A couple spends around $1,028 per month in Ondo vs $2,557 in Ubud, Bali, rent included.
🙂A family of three spends $1,620 per month in Ondo vs $3,723 in Ubud, Bali, rent included.
🙂Ondo is about 69% cheaper than Ubud, Bali,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.
📊Ondo sits 67% below the global median, while Ubud, Bali is 5% above – they fall on opposite sides of the world average.

💰Salaries run about 536% higher in Ubud, Bali,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$49.00 in Ondo versus $32.00 in Ubud, Bali. Groceries tell a different story – $191 in Ondo vs $298 in Ubud, Bali – so Ondo wins on supermarket bills even if dining out costs more.
